Emblem problem?

I put my lorinser badge on the back of my car and it is slightly crooked. Should I just leave it and see if people notice, or if I take it off how can I put it back on? What sticky stuff should I use??

try "goof off" or some WD-40

spray under the emblem. then get some dental floss and "floss" the emblem off. clean up thoroughly, and wax the portion of the car, then re-apply the emblem. i would say, get some double faced tape, but someone pointed out that 3m makes a good tape to use. i don't know where to get it though....
